Boundary warning device for building construction
Technical Field
The utility model belongs to the technical field of the construction, especially, relate to a border warning device for construction.
Background
The construction site refers to a construction site where construction activities such as house construction, civil engineering, equipment installation, and pipeline laying are performed in industrial and civil projects, and the construction site is approved to be occupied, and a site where safety production, civilized work, and construction are performed by human beings, including all regions where construction work can be performed on land, sea, and in the air. The project manager is responsible for the field management of the construction process, and the project manager establishes the management responsibility of the construction field and organizes and implements the management responsibility according to the project scale, the technical complexity and the specific situation of the construction field.
At present, some dangerous places are inevitable at a construction site, and warning boards are placed in the dangerous places for warning.
However, the boundary warning device for the existing building construction generally stands a warning frame to warn constructors, the warning mode cannot be adjusted at will, and people cannot be well noticed.

Fig. 1-3 show that the utility model discloses a border warning device for construction of embodiment, it includes: the C-shaped support 1, four supporting legs 22 are fixedly arranged at the bottom of the C-shaped support 1, the four supporting legs 22 are respectively positioned at four corners of the bottom of the C-shaped support 1, a motor 2 is fixedly arranged in the middle of the lower surface of the C-shaped support 1, a protective assembly is sleeved outside the motor 2 and comprises a protective shell 23, the upper end of the protective shell 23 is fixedly connected with the bottom of the C-shaped support 1, a window is formed in the side wall of the protective shell 23, a radiating net 24 is arranged at the inner side of the window, a cavity is formed in the bottom plate of the C-shaped support 1 and extends to the lower side of the waist side plate of the C-shaped support 1, the output end of the top end of the motor 2 is connected with a first rotating shaft 3, the upper end of the first rotating shaft 3 extends to the top end in the cavity, a lifting and rotating mechanism is arranged in the middle of the inner side of the C-shaped support 1, a vertical groove is formed in the inner side plate of the waist side plate of the C-shaped support 1, and a cleaning mechanism is arranged in the groove.
The lifting and rotating mechanism comprises a vertical second rotating shaft 5, one end of the second rotating shaft 5 is connected with the inner top end of the C-shaped support 1, the other end of the second rotating shaft extends to the inner bottom of the cavity, a gear 6 is fixedly sleeved on the outer side surface of the second rotating shaft 5 in the cavity, the gear 6 is connected with an incomplete gear 4 in a meshed mode, specifically, a clamping tooth structure meshed with the gear 6 is arranged at one fourth of the rim of the incomplete gear 4, the diameter of the incomplete gear 4 is the same as that of the gear 6, the incomplete gear 4 is fixedly sleeved on the outer side of the first rotating shaft 3, a fixing plate 20 is fixedly sleeved on the upper end of the outer side surface of the second rotating shaft 5, a first reciprocating screw rod 7 is fixedly arranged in the middle of the outer side surface of the second rotating shaft 5, a first bearing seat 8 is connected on the outer side surface of the first reciprocating screw rod 7 in a meshed mode, and a first bamboo joint type telescopic rod 18 is directly connected with the inner bottom of the first bearing seat 8 and the C-shaped support 1, the outer side surface of the first bearing seat 8 is rotatably connected with a sleeve 9, a second bamboo joint type telescopic rod 19 is connected between the top of the sleeve 9 and a fixing plate 20, and four warning plates 10 which are uniformly distributed are fixedly connected to the outer side surface of the sleeve 9.
The cleaning mechanism comprises a vertical third rotating shaft 12, the upper end of the third rotating shaft 12 is connected with the top in the groove, the lower end of the third rotating shaft 12 extends to the inner bottom in the cavity, a second chain wheel 13 is fixedly sleeved at the lower end of the outer side surface of the third rotating shaft 12 in the cavity, a chain 14 is arranged at the outer side of the second chain wheel 13, the second chain wheel 13 is connected with a first chain wheel 11 through the chain 14, the first chain wheel 11 is fixedly sleeved at the outer side of the first rotating shaft 3, a second reciprocating screw rod 15 is fixedly arranged in the middle of the third rotating shaft 12, a second bearing block 16 is meshed and connected with the outer side surface of the second reciprocating screw rod 15, one side of the second bearing block 16 is slidably connected with the inner side wall of the groove, specifically, a vertical chute is arranged on one side wall in the groove, a limiting slide block 21 is slidably connected in the chute, one end of the limiting slide block 21 protrudes out of the chute and is fixedly connected with the second bearing block 16, a cleaning brush 17 is fixedly connected to the side of the second bearing seat 16 facing the opening of the groove.
Furthermore, the upper end and the lower end of each first bamboo joint type telescopic rod 18 are respectively fixedly connected with the first bearing seat 8 and the C-shaped support 1, four first bamboo joint type telescopic rods 18 are arranged and are uniformly distributed in the front-back direction, the left side and the right side, and the first bearing seats 8 cannot rotate relative to the C-shaped support 1 through the first bamboo joint type telescopic rods 18 but can move up and down; the upper end and the lower end of the second bamboo joint type telescopic rod 19 are respectively fixedly connected with the fixing plate 20 and the sleeve 9, the second bamboo joint type telescopic rods 19 are arranged in two and are distributed in parallel in the left and right direction, and the sleeve 9 and the second rotating shaft 5 can synchronously rotate and can be lifted and moved through the arrangement of the second bamboo joint type telescopic rods 19.
Further, the warning plate 10 is arranged to be of a vertical arc-shaped plate structure, the circle center of the radian is located on the axis of the second rotating shaft 5, and the cleaning brush 17 is arranged to be of an arc-shaped strip structure matched with the outer side face of the warning plate 10.
Furthermore, the joints of the first rotating shaft 3, the second rotating shaft 5 and the third rotating shaft 12 with the C-shaped support 1 are movably connected through rolling bearings, and the joint of the sleeve 9 and the first bearing seat 8 is movably connected through rolling bearings.
Further, the C-shaped support 1 comprises a bottom plate, a waist side plate and a top plate, the top plate and the bottom plate are parallel to each other from top to bottom, the waist side plate is located on one side between the top plate and the bottom plate, and the upper end and the lower end of the waist plate are fixedly connected with the top plate and the bottom plate respectively.
The working principle is as follows:
when the utility model is used, the motor 2 drives the first rotating shaft 3 to rotate, the first rotating shaft 3 drives the second rotating shaft 5 to indirectly rotate through the cooperation of the incomplete gear 4 and the gear 6, so that the first reciprocating screw rod 7 and the sleeve 9 synchronously indirectly rotate, and then four warning boards 10 indirectly rotate (the incomplete gear 4 rotates for a circle to cause the gear 6 to rotate for a quarter circle, namely the first rotating shaft 3 rotates for a circle, the second rotating shaft 5 rotates for a quarter circle, just four warning boards 10 synchronously rotate with the second rotating shaft 5 are switched once), the rotating first reciprocating screw rod 7 drives the first bearing seat 8 to repeatedly move up and down, the first bearing seat 8 drives the four warning boards 10 to repeatedly move up and down through the sleeve 9, thereby the four warning boards 10 can also repeatedly move up and down when being switched to succinctly, further, the warning board 10 can attract the attention of constructors, the warning board 10 can be observed at multiple angles, and the warning effect is greatly improved.
When the motor 2 works, the first rotating shaft 3 drives the first chain wheel 11 to rotate, the first chain wheel 11 drives the second chain wheel 13 to rotate through the chain 14, the second chain wheel 13 drives the second reciprocating screw rod 15 to rotate through the third rotating shaft 12, the rotating second reciprocating screw rod 15 drives the second bearing seat 16 to move up and down repeatedly, thereby make cleaning brush 17 to warning board 10 upper and lower brush (the setting of the different diameters of accessible first sprocket 11 and second sprocket 13, and the setting of the reciprocal screw thread density of second, can make cleaning brush 17 carry out at least once in the period of warning board 10 quiescing from the top to the bottom or from the bottom to the brush of reaching the top, guarantee that whole warning board 10's lateral surface is once by the brush at least, thereby guaranteed cleaning brush 17 to warning board 10's clean effect, make warning board 10 surface remain throughout clean, thereby the warning efficiency of warning board 10 has been guaranteed.
